Hi, what you might want to do is find the serial number, it will be either on the dash placard or if you are standing behind the tractor looking forward it will be on the upper right hand side of the chassis, below the fuel tank, it will be stamped into the case. Check and see if it has an hour meter, take pictures of the sprockets in the rear and tracks, and pictures that show overall condition of the tractor as best you can. That will help a bunch, good luck; Tad
